US Number of 16 Years and Over Female Civilians Employed By Detailed Occupation in 2021 (ACS-5Yrs)

Updated on November 7, 2025.

Based on the US Census ACS-5Yrs estimates, in 2021, the number of employed US Female civilians (16 years and over) was 74,610,341.

The occupation with the highest number of employed female civilians (16 years and over) was Registered nurses (2,967,153 people), followed by Elementary and middle school teachers (2,659,911 people), Secretaries and administrative assistants, except legal, medical, and executive (2,339,575 people) and Cashiers (2,268,955 people).

The chart below shows the top 10 detailed occupations by the number of US female civilians (16 years and over) employed in that occupation. The table below shows the number of employed female civilians and the percentage of the total employed female civilians for all occupations.
